     You asked why did I seek help from the RP population on a service
     question.
     
     I don't always, but in this case I did so because past on-line
     discussions led me to believe there was more laser expertise available
     on the mailing list than at 3D. And perhaps this is true, as I got
     responses from others who have experienced the same problem and could
     not get it corrected through 3D's tech service.
     
     One other time I had asked a question of Stratasys, and when the
     answer was slow in coming I posted it on the list. Very soon after,
     an engineer at Stratasys replied to my mailing list posting with the
     answer. In this case, the mailing list got their attention faster
     then the usual channels (which was what I was hoping for).
     
     I know from these events that companies like 3D Systems and Stratasys
     read the RP mailing list, and I use the list as a motivater when I
     need to prod a company to action.
     
     This doesn't always work, however. Other SLA users and I have posted
     several complaints about 3D Systems' decision not to support HP
     workstation users with the latest software -- even though we paid
     their incredibly high price for software maintenance. In this
     particular instance, I am disappointed to learn how unwilling 3D is to
     address the issue in this public forum.
     
     Any regular reader of the list will know I am not the only one
     (Elaine) who uses the list in an attempt to prod the big companies
     into providing what we feel is the appropriate level of customer
     service -- whether it works or not.
